Настройка рабочих нагрузок в емкости Premium

В этой статье перечислены рабочие нагрузки для Power BI Premium и описаны их емкости.

Примечание.

Рабочие нагрузки можно включить и назначить емкости с помощью REST API емкости .

Поддерживаемые рабочие нагрузки

Рабочие нагрузки запросов оптимизированы для ресурсов, определенных номером SKU емкости Premium. Емкости класса Premium также поддерживают дополнительные рабочие нагрузки, которые могут использовать ресурсы емкости.

Список приведенных ниже рабочих нагрузок описывает, какие номера SKU уровня "Премиум" поддерживают каждую рабочую нагрузку:

  • ИИ . Все номера SKU поддерживаются отдельно от SKU EM1/A1

  • Семантические модели . Поддерживаются все номера SKU

  • Потоки данных — поддерживаются все номера SKU

  • Отчеты с разбивкой на страницы — поддерживаются все номера SKU

Настройка рабочих нагрузок

Вы можете настроить поведение рабочих нагрузок, настроив параметры рабочей нагрузки для емкости.

Важно!

Все рабочие нагрузки всегда включены и не могут быть отключены. Ресурсы емкости управляются Power BI в соответствии с использованием емкости.

Настройка рабочих нагрузок на портале администрирования Power BI

  1. Войдите в Power BI с помощью учетных данных учетной записи администратора.

  2. В заголовке страницы выберите ...>>портал Параметры Администратор.

    Settings menu with admin portal selected.

  3. Перейдите к параметрам емкости и на вкладке Power BI Premium выберите емкость.

  4. Разверните рабочие нагрузки.

  5. Задайте значения для каждой рабочей нагрузки в соответствии с вашими спецификациями.

  6. Нажмите Применить.

Мониторинг рабочих нагрузок

Используйте приложение метрик емкости Microsoft Fabric для мониторинга активности емкости.

Важно!

Если емкость Power BI Premium имеет высокий уровень использования ресурсов, что приводит к проблемам с производительностью или надежностью, вы можете получать уведомления по электронной почте для выявления и устранения проблемы. Это может быть упрощенный способ устранения неполадок перегруженных емкостей. Дополнительные сведения см. в статье Уведомления.

ИИ (предварительная версия)

Рабочая нагрузка искусственного интеллекта позволяет использовать когнитивные службы и автоматизированные Машинное обучение в Power BI. Используйте следующие параметры для управления поведением рабочей нагрузки.

Имя параметра Description
Максимальная память (%)1 Максимальный процент доступной памяти, которую процессы ИИ могут использовать в емкости.
Разрешить использование из Power BI Desktop Этот параметр зарезервирован для дальнейшего использования и не отображается во всех клиентах.
Разрешить создание моделей машинного обучения Указывает, могут ли бизнес-аналитики обучать, проверять и вызывать модели машинного обучения непосредственно в Power BI. Дополнительные сведения см. в статье "Автоматизированные Машинное обучение" в Power BI (предварительная версия).
Включение параллелизма для запросов ИИ Указывает, могут ли запросы ИИ выполняться параллельно.

1Premium не требует изменения параметров памяти. Память в Premium автоматически управляется базовой системой.

Семантические модели

В этом разделе описаны следующие параметры рабочей нагрузки семантических моделей:

Параметры Power BI

Используйте параметры в таблице ниже для управления поведением рабочей нагрузки. Параметры со ссылкой содержат дополнительные сведения, которые можно просмотреть в указанных разделах под таблицей.

Имя параметра Description
Максимальная память (%)1 Максимальный процент доступной памяти, которую семантические модели могут использовать в емкости.
Конечная точка XMLA Указывает, что подключения из клиентских приложений учитывают членство в группах безопасности на уровне рабочей области и приложений. Дополнительные сведения см. в Подключение семантических моделей с клиентскими приложениями и инструментами.
Максимальное число промежуточных наборов строк Максимальное количество промежуточных строк, возвращаемых DirectQuery. Значение по умолчанию — 1000000, а допустимый диапазон — от 100000 до 2147483646. Верхний предел может потребоваться дополнительно ограничить в зависимости от того, что поддерживает источник данных.
Максимальный размер автономной семантической модели (ГБ) Максимальный размер автономной семантической модели в памяти. Это сжатый размер на диске. Значение по умолчанию — 0, которое является самым высоким ограничением, определенным номером SKU. Допустимый диапазон составляет от 0 до предельного размера емкости.
Максимальное число строк результатов Максимальное количество строк, возвращаемых в запросе DAX. Значение по умолчанию — 2147483647, а допустимый диапазон составляет от 100000 до 2147483647.
Ограничение памяти запроса (%) Максимальный процент доступной памяти в рабочей нагрузке, которую можно использовать для выполнения запроса многомерных выражений или DAX. Значение по умолчанию равно 0, что приводит к применению ограничения памяти автоматического запроса для конкретного номера SKU.
Время ожидания запроса (секунды) Максимальное время ожидания запроса. Значение по умолчанию — 3600 секунд (1 час). Значение 0 указывает, что запросы не будут истекает.
Автоматическое обновление страницы Переключатель "Вкл.", чтобы разрешить рабочим областям класса Premium иметь отчеты с автоматическим обновлением страницы на основе фиксированных интервалов.
Минимальный интервал обновления Если автоматическое обновление страницы включено, минимальный интервал, разрешенный для интервала обновления страницы. Значение по умолчанию — пять минут, и минимально допустимое значение составляет одну секунду.
Мера обнаружения изменений Переключатель "Вкл.", чтобы рабочие области уровня "Премиум" имели отчеты с автоматическим обновлением страницы на основе обнаружения изменений.
Минимальный интервал выполнения Если мера обнаружения изменений включена, минимальный интервал выполнения, разрешенный для опроса изменений данных. Значение по умолчанию — пять секунд, а минимальное допустимое значение составляет одну секунду.

1Premium не требует изменения параметров памяти. Память в Premium автоматически управляется базовой системой.

Максимальное число промежуточных наборов строк

Используйте этот параметр для управления воздействием ресурсоемких или плохо разработанных отчетов. Когда запрос к семантической модели DirectQuery приводит к очень большому результату из исходной базы данных, это может привести к всплеску нагрузки на использование памяти и обработку. Эта ситуация может привести к низкому объему ресурсов для других пользователей и отчетов. Этот параметр позволяет администратору емкости настроить количество строк отдельного запроса, которые могут получить из источника данных.

Кроме того, если емкость может поддерживать более миллиона строк по умолчанию, и у вас есть большая семантическая модель, увеличьте этот параметр, чтобы получить больше строк.

Этот параметр влияет только на запросы DirectQuery, в то время как максимальное число результирующих наборов строк влияет на запросы DAX.

Максимальный размер модели автономной семантики

Используйте этот параметр, чтобы запретить создателям отчетов публиковать большую семантику модели, которая может негативно повлиять на емкость. Power BI не может определить фактический размер в памяти, пока семантическая модель не загружается в память. Возможно, семантическая модель с меньшим объемом автономного размера может иметь больший объем памяти, чем семантическая модель с большим размером в автономном режиме.

Если у вас есть существующая семантическая модель, которая превышает указанный размер этого параметра, семантическая модель не будет загружаться, когда пользователь пытается получить к нему доступ. Семантическая модель также может не загружаться, если она больше максимальной памяти, настроенной для рабочей нагрузки семантических моделей.

Этот параметр применим для моделей в формате хранилища небольших семантических моделей (формат ABF) и в формате хранилища больших семантических моделей (PremiumFiles), хотя автономный размер одной модели может отличаться при хранении в одном формате и другом. Дополнительные сведения см. в разделе "Большие модели" в Power BI Premium.

Чтобы обеспечить производительность системы, применяется дополнительный жесткий потолок SKU для максимального размера автономной семантической модели независимо от настроенного значения. Дополнительный жесткий потолок SKU в приведенной ниже таблице не применяется к семантической модели Power BI, хранящейся в формате хранилища больших семантических моделей.

номер SKU Ограничение1
F2 1 ГБ
F4 2 ГБ
F8/EM1/A1 3 ГБ.
F16/EM2/A2 5 ГБ
F32/EM3/A3 6 ГБ
F64/P1/A4 10 ГБ
F128/P2/A5 10 ГБ
F256/P3/A6 10 ГБ
F512/P4/A7 10 ГБ
F1024/P5/A8 10 ГБ
F2048 10 ГБ

1Жесткий потолок для максимального размера семантической модели в автономном режиме (небольшой формат хранилища).

Максимальное число результирующих наборов строк

Используйте этот параметр для управления воздействием ресурсоемких или плохо разработанных отчетов. Если это ограничение достигнуто в запросе DAX, пользователь отчета увидит следующую ошибку. Они должны скопировать сведения об ошибке и обратиться к администратору.

Couldn't load data for this visual

Этот параметр влияет только на запросы DAX, в то время как максимальное число промежуточных наборов строк влияет на запросы DirectQuery.

Ограничение памяти запроса

Используйте этот параметр для управления воздействием ресурсоемких или плохо разработанных отчетов. Некоторые запросы и вычисления могут привести к промежуточным результатам, которые используют большую память в емкости. Эта ситуация может привести к тому, что другие запросы выполняются очень медленно, вызывают вытеснение других семантических моделей из емкости и приводят к ошибкам памяти для других пользователей емкости.

Этот параметр применяется ко всем запросам DAX и многомерным выражениям, выполняемым отчетами Power BI, анализом в отчетах Excel, а также к другим средствам, которые могут подключаться к конечной точке XMLA.

Операции обновления данных также могут выполнять запросы DAX в рамках обновления плиток панели мониторинга и визуальных кэшей после обновления данных в семантической модели. Такие запросы также могут завершиться ошибкой из-за этого параметра, и это может привести к операции обновления данных, отображаемой в состоянии сбоя, даже если данные в семантической модели успешно обновлены.

Значение по умолчанию равно 0, что приводит к применению следующего ограничения памяти автоматического запроса для конкретного номера SKU.

номер SKU Ограничение памяти автоматического запроса
F2 1 ГБ
F4 1 ГБ
F8/EM1/A1 1 ГБ
F16/EM2/A2 2 ГБ
F32/EM3/A3 5 ГБ
F64/P1/A4 10 ГБ
F128/P2/A5 10 ГБ
F256/P3/A6 10 ГБ
F512/P4/A7 20 ГБ
F1024/P5/A8 40 ГБ
F2048 40 ГБ

Ограничение запроса для рабочей области, которая не назначена емкости Premium, составляет 1 ГБ.

Время ожидания запроса

Используйте этот параметр для более эффективного управления длительными запросами, что может привести к медленной загрузке отчетов для пользователей.

Этот параметр применяется ко всем запросам DAX и многомерным выражениям, выполняемым отчетами Power BI, анализом в отчетах Excel, а также к другим средствам, которые могут подключаться к конечной точке XMLA.

Операции обновления данных также могут выполнять запросы DAX в рамках обновления плиток панели мониторинга и визуальных кэшей после обновления данных в семантической модели. Такие запросы также могут завершиться ошибкой из-за этого параметра, и это может привести к операции обновления данных, отображаемой в состоянии сбоя, даже если данные в семантической модели успешно обновлены.

Этот параметр применяется к одному запросу, а не к продолжительности времени выполнения всех запросов, связанных с обновлением семантической модели или отчета. Рассмотрим следующий пример:

  • Значение времени ожидания запроса — 1200 (20 минут).
  • Выполняется пять запросов, каждый из которых выполняется 15 минут.

Объединенное время для всех запросов составляет 75 минут, но ограничение параметра не достигается, так как все отдельные запросы выполняются менее 20 минут.

Обратите внимание, что отчеты Power BI переопределяют этот параметр по умолчанию с гораздо меньшим временем ожидания для каждого запроса к емкости. Время ожидания для каждого запроса обычно составляет около трех минут.

Автоматическое обновление страницы

При включении автоматическое обновление страниц позволяет пользователям в емкости Premium обновлять страницы в отчете через определенный интервал для источников DirectQuery. В качестве администратора емкости можно выполнить следующие действия:

  • Включение и отключение автоматического обновления страницы
  • Определение минимального интервала обновления

Чтобы найти параметр автоматического обновления страницы, выполните следующие действия.

  1. На портале Power BI Администратор выберите параметры емкости.

  2. Выберите емкость, а затем прокрутите вниз и разверните меню "Рабочие нагрузки ".

  3. Прокрутите вниз до раздела "Семантические модели ".

Screenshot that shows the admin setting for automatic refresh interval.

Запросы, созданные автоматическим обновлением страницы, переходят непосредственно к источнику данных, поэтому важно учитывать надежность и загрузку этих источников при включении автоматического обновления страниц в организации.

Свойства сервера служб Analysis Services

Power BI Premium поддерживает дополнительные свойства сервера Служб Analysis Services. Чтобы просмотреть эти свойства, обратитесь к свойствам сервера в службах Analysis Services.

коммутатор портала Администратор

Параметр свойств сервера на основе XMLA служб Analysis Services включен по умолчанию. При включении администраторы рабочих областей могут изменять поведение для отдельной рабочей области. Измененные свойства применяются только к этой рабочей области. Чтобы переключить параметры свойств сервера служб Analysis Services, выполните приведенные ниже действия.

  1. Перейдите к параметрам емкости.

  2. Выберите емкость, в которой нужно отключить свойства сервера Служб Analysis Services.

  3. Разверните рабочие нагрузки.

  4. В семантических моделях выберите нужный параметр для параметров рабочей области на основе XMLA (которые могут переопределить параметры емкости).

    Screenshot that shows the admin setting for disabling the analysis services server properties.

Потоки данных

Рабочая нагрузка потоков данных позволяет использовать самостоятельные подготовки данных для приема, преобразования, интеграции и обогащения данных. Используйте следующие параметры для управления поведением рабочей нагрузки в Premium. Power BI Premium не требует изменения параметров памяти. Память в Premium автоматически управляется базовой системой.

Расширенный вычислительный модуль потоков данных

Чтобы воспользоваться новым вычислительным ядром, разделить прием данных на отдельные потоки данных и поместить логику преобразования в вычисляемых сущностях в разных потоках данных. Этот подход рекомендуется, так как подсистема вычислений работает над потоками данных, ссылающимися на существующий поток данных. Он не работает при приеме потоков данных. Следуя этому руководству, новый вычислительный модуль обрабатывает шаги преобразования, такие как соединения и слияния, для оптимальной производительности.

Отчеты, разбитые на страницы

Рабочая нагрузка отчетов с разбивкой на страницы позволяет запускать отчеты с разбивкой на страницы на основе стандартного формата служб SQL Server Reporting Services в служба Power BI.

Отчеты с разбивкой на страницы предоставляют те же возможности, что и отчеты SQL Server Reporting Services (SSRS), включая возможность авторов отчетов добавлять пользовательский код. Это позволяет авторам динамически изменять отчеты, например изменять цвета текста на основе выражений кода.

Исходящее соединение

Исходящее подключение включается по умолчанию. Он позволяет отчетам с разбивкой на страницы выполнять запросы на получение внешних ресурсов, таких как изображения, и вызывать внешние API и функции Azure, определенные с помощью пользовательского кода в отчетах с разбивкой на страницы. Глобальный администратор или администратор служба Power BI может отключить этот параметр на портале администрирования Power BI.

Чтобы получить доступ к параметрам исходящего подключения, выполните следующие действия.

  1. В служба Power BI перейдите на портал администрирования.

  2. На вкладке Power BI Premium выберите емкость, для которой нужно отключить исходящие запросы отчетов с разбивкой на страницы.

  3. Разверните рабочие нагрузки.

    Переключатель исходящего подключения находится в разделе отчетов с разбивкой на страницы.

    • При отключении отключения исходящего Подключение выключения включено исходящее подключение.

    • Если включен исходящий Подключение ivity Disable, исходящие подключения отключены.

  4. После внесения изменений нажмите кнопку "Применить".

    A screenshot of the paginated reports outbound connectivity setting.

Рабочая нагрузка отчетов с разбивкой на страницы включена автоматически и всегда включена.